Understanding UPVC Locks
UPVC or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ride locks are particularly designed for UPVC doors. They are identified by their multi-point locking systems, which engage several locking points along the door frame for boosted security. Comprehending how they operate is necessary when thinking about a replacement.
Types of UPVC Door Locks
Prior to changing a UPVC door lock, it is vital to identify which type is currently in location. Here are the main kinds of locks:
Euro Cylinder Locks: Commonly used in UPVC doors, these locks are operated by a secret from both sides and can be quickly changed.Night Latch Locks: Similar to traditional latch locks, these offer additional security but may not be as robust as Euro cylinders.Mortice Locks: Installed inside the door, they supply outstanding security however require expert installation.Why You Might Need to Replace Your UPVC Door Lock
There are a number of reasons that a property owner may require to consider replacing their UPVC door lock:
Wear and Tear: Over the years, friction can wear down the internal systems of the lock.Malfunction: A locked door that won't open or close can indicate internal failure.Security Upgrade: Replacing an old lock with a more recent design can substantially boost security functions.Lost Keys: In instances where secrets are lost or taken, it's sensible to replace the lock to keep security.Signs Your UPVC Door Lock Needs Replacement
Recognizing the signs that your UPVC door lock may require replacement is vital for preserving security. Here are some common indications:
Difficulty in turning the keyThe lock feels loose or shakyThe latch does not totally engage or disengageVisible damage to the lock mechanismStep-by-Step Guide to Replacing a UPVC Door Lock
Changing a UPVC door lock can be achieved by the majority of DIY enthusiasts with the right tools and guidance. Here's a detailed guide:
Tools NeededScrewdriver (flathead and Phillips)Allen keyReplacement lockLube (optional)Replacement Steps
Remove the Door Handle:
Unscrew the screws holding the handle in location using a screwdriver.
Unscrew the Lock Cylinder:
Locate the screws on the edge of the door that hold the lock cylinder in location.Get rid of the screws and carefully pull the cylinder out.
Measure the Old Cylinder:
Measure the length of the old cylinder to make sure the new one fits correctly.
Install the New Cylinder:
Insert the new cylinder into the door frame, making certain it fits snugly.Re-secure the screws to hold the cylinder in place.
Reattach the Door Handle:
Align the handle with the door's pre-drilled holes and screw it back into location.
Evaluate the Lock:
Test the lock by engaging and disengaging it numerous times to make sure smooth operation.
Lubricate the Lock (optional):
